Earthquake Emergency in Venezuela

Jun 27, 2026

The donations, collected through Action for a United World (AMU) and Action for New Families (AFN), will be used to provide essential aid and support for the reconstruction of homes for the people of Venezuela affected by the powerful earthquake on June 24, 2026.

The Focolare Movement’s Emergency Coordination Team has launched a special fundraising campaign to support the people of Venezuela through Action for a United World (AMU) and Action for New Families (AFN). The donations received will be managed jointly by AMU and AFN to provide the people affected by the June 24, 2026, earthquake with essential aid for food, medical care, housing, and shelter in various cities across the country, in collaboration with local churches.

Every contribution will provide immediate support and allow us to imagine together a future of hope and reconstruction.
